![freeze top 3 rows in excel 2016 freeze top 3 rows in excel 2016](https://www.officetooltips.com/images/tips/25_365/3.png)
Freeze top 3 rows in excel 2016 code#
While the code here is VBA, it should be directly transcribable to other languages and platforms.
Freeze top 3 rows in excel 2016 how to#
The core process is really just a reiteration of previously submitted answers but I thought it was important to demonstrate how to deal with ActiveWindow when you are not within Excel's own VBA. For example, we want to freeze the top 3 rows, so I have clicked row 4 in the picture below. Step 2: Click the row number at the left side of the spreadsheet that is below the bottom-most row that you want to freeze. Step 1: Open your spreadsheet in Excel 2013. SaveAs FileName:=fn, FileFormat:=xlOpenXMLWorkbook This same process can be applied to any number of the top rows in your spreadsheet. If CBool(Len(Dir(fn, vbNormal))) Then Kill fn
![freeze top 3 rows in excel 2016 freeze top 3 rows in excel 2016](https://www.99mediasector.com/wp-content/uploads/2020/08/freeze-two-or-more-columns-and-row-min.jpg)
'This is where the Freeze Pane is dealt withįn = CurrentProject.Path & "\Reports\Report_" & Format(Date, "yyyymmdd") & ".xlsx" (Placing my cursor several rows down, Highlighting several rows, Merging several rows, etc.) Nothing seems to work. I have tried all kinds of work-arounds with no luck. Set xlApp = CreateObject("Excel.Application") I am unable to freeze several rows because the 'View' drop down menu only allows you 3 choices: 1. You can freeze just the top row and first column. Option Explicitĭim xlApp As Excel.Application, ws As Worksheet, wb As Workbook Lock specific rows or columns in place by freezing panes, so you can scroll through an Excel spreadsheet and still see the top row or left column. Using the Excel.Application object in another Office application's VBA project will require you to add Microsoft Excel 15.0 Object library (or equivalent for your own version). Go through the drop-down menu and click the 'Freeze panes option.' 4. When you find it, check for the 'Freeze panes button' and click on it. S own VBA, the ActiveWindow property must be addressed as a child of the Excel.Application object.Įxample for creating an Excel workbook from Access: Check the top of the spreadsheet and click the 'view tab.' 3. To expand this question into the realm of use outside of Excel Nu bn c mt hng hoc ct c ng bng th khi bn nhp vo Freeze Panes, bn s nhn c Unreeze Panes, Freeze Top.